Core Viewpoint - The article discusses the transformative impact of global regulations and technological innovations on airport security screening processes, highlighting the adoption of advanced technologies like CT scanners and AI to enhance efficiency and compliance with safety standards [3][4][32]. Group 1: Regulatory Influence - Global regulations are driving the adoption of advanced airport security technologies, with the EU leading by mandating the deployment of CT scanners by 2025 [3]. - The TSA in the U.S. is taking a phased approach, prioritizing high-risk locations for the deployment of new technologies [3]. - There is a push for standardization in security processes to align with global best practices, which may lead to new compliance requirements [3]. Group 2: Technological Innovations - The introduction of CT scanners has revolutionized baggage screening by providing 3D imaging, significantly improving the detection of prohibited items [4][5]. - Passengers no longer need to remove liquids and electronics from their bags during screening, expediting the process [5]. - Smaller airports are adopting CT technology more rapidly than larger international hubs due to fewer infrastructure challenges [5]. Group 3: Controversies and Challenges - The reintroduction of liquid restrictions in the UK and EU has sparked controversy, as airports that invested in CT technology face operational and financial setbacks [7]. - The inconsistency in security processes across different airports creates confusion and delays for travelers [10][11]. Group 4: Future Developments - The HelixView system, currently in development, aims to streamline security checks at smaller airports by allowing passengers to keep liquids and electronics in their bags [9]. - The integration of AI in security systems is expected to enhance threat detection and reduce human error [28][29]. - The introduction of walk-through scanners and advanced imaging technologies is anticipated to improve passenger experience and security efficiency [20][22][26]. Group 5: Industry Standards and Training - The launch of the DXCT testing platform aims to standardize the training and certification of security personnel globally, addressing inconsistencies in skill levels [17][19]. - The collaboration between the UK Civil Aviation Authority and Rapi Scan seeks to enhance the professional capabilities of X-ray security personnel [17]. Group 6: Summary of Impacts - The advancements in security technology are expected to lead to a smoother and less invasive airport screening experience for travelers, with potential reductions in liquid restrictions and the widespread adoption of walk-through scanners [32]. - Airports that adopt these advanced security solutions may gain a competitive edge by offering faster screening and improved passenger experiences [32].
